Srinagar: Apni Party on Saturday held organisational meetings in the DH Pora and Zainapora constituencies to elect office-bearers at the zonal and block levels as part of its efforts to strengthen the party structure at the grassroots.
The meetings were held under the supervision of the party’s returning officer, Abdul Majeed Padder.
According to a party statement, Abdul Hameed Dar was elected Zonal President for the DH Pora constituency, while Miss Shazia was elected President of the Women’s Wing for the constituency.
At the block level, Mohammad Ayoub Bhat was elected Block President for DH Pora, Ghulam Mohammad Malik, also known as Akbar, for DK Marg, Mohammad Altaf for Phaloo, and Tajamul Shafi Magray for Manzgam. Aijaz Ahmad Malik was elected Block President (Youth) for Manzgam.
In the Zainapora constituency of Shopian district, Mohammad Aslam Naik was elected Zonal President. Arif Ahmad Lone was elected Block President for Zainapora, Mushtaq Ahmed Thoker for Chitragam, Khurshid Ahmad for Imamsahib, Mohammad Yaqoob Padder for Harmain, Mohd Aslam Sheikh for Kaprin and Javid Ahmad Rather for Kangiuallar.
